Idina Menzel, the Tony award-winning Broadway actress from the smash hit musical “Wicked,” is featured on the soundtrack for the newly released film “Beowulf,” which is now in theatres, according to an article posted Wednesday, Nov. 21 at BroadwayWorld.com.
The song, “A Hero Comes Home,” was produced by Glen Ballard and the film - based on the classic novel that tells the story of the mighty warrior Beowulf and his fight with the demon Grendel – was directed by Oscar winner Robert Zemeckis. The score was directed by Oscar nominated composer Alan Silvestri (Forrest Gump, The Polar Express), who has won Grammy Awards for “Back to the Future” and “Who Framed Roger Rabbit.”
Menzel, who is gearing up to release her new solo album “I Stand,” just put out another new single – available on iTunes – “Brave” and can also be seen in the new Disney film “Enchanted” which is also currently out in theatres.
